打开vscode编辑器,导入刚刚在d盘新建一个项目 1:tsc --init 在编辑器Visual StudioCode打开一个终端 5640239-57e3d1b3391f40b0.png 进入项目,执行命令tsc --init,这个时候可以看到生成了一个ts的配置文件 5640239-5dc703ca369c2161.png 打开ts的配置文件 (生成tsconfig.json ),将改 "outDir": "./js", 表...
vue.js 学习笔记3——TypeScript 工具 npm install -g typescript#安装typescript 工具tsc编译器tsc a.ts#输出 a.jsnode a.js#运行js typescript 通过tsconfig.json 文件配置。 可通过gulp 等工具管理项目自动化编译和运行。 基础类型 boolean 布尔、number 数字、string 字符串、enum 枚举、any 任意、void 空...
下面我们了解一下vue-class-component的作用。 vue-class-component & vue-property-decorator vue-class-component 强化 Vue 组件,使用装饰器语法使 Vue 组件更好的跟TS结合使用。 vue-property-decorator在 vue-class-component 的基础上增加了更多与 Vue 相关的装饰器,使Vue组件更好的跟TS结合使用。 这两者都是...
而在 TS 中,method 不需要额外的装饰器——实例方法就会自动成为 Vue 组件的 method。类似的还有 data ,使用 TS 的语法,实例字段即可自动成为 Vue 组件的 data。 Computed 在传统的使用 JS 编写的 Vue 代码中,如果要定义计算属性,我们需要在 computed 属性中定义相应的函数。而这在 ES 中其实早就已经有了对应...
pnpm create vite vue-ts-app --template vue-ts 三、运行项目 安装插件:npm install 运行项目:npm run dev { "name": "vue-ts-app", "private": true, "version": "0.0.0", "type": "module", "scripts": { "dev": "vite", "build": "vue-tsc && vite build", ...
安装成功之后,你会发现你拥有了一个命令tsc(TypeScript compiler)。然后可以运行一下命令查看版本 tsc --version 然后再新创建一个文件夹,命名为ts-study 在其中创建一个ts文件 将一个ts文件编译js文件 tsc 文件名.ts 生成项目的ts配置文件 tsc --init ...
vue3.0项目实战系列文章 - 菜单的实现及icon组件封装 一、关于对TypeScript的疑问 1.ts中的数据类型 ts必须指定数据类型(给人理解将数据类型分成3种) 1.js有的类型 boolean类型、number类型、string类型、array类型、undefined、null 2.ts多出的类型 tuple类型(元组类型)、enum类型(枚举类型)、any类型(任意类型) ...
vue 是使用 TypeScript 编写的,在 npm scripts中通过 tsc 命令来生成类型定义文件到临时文件夹: 并通过 api-extractor 将中的多个进行处理和合并。 注意:使用和来指定类型声明文件,而非,用来指定文件模块方案,通常为或(默认)。 3.社区维护的声明文件
在命令行输入 tsc --init ,这是 TypeScript 提供的初始化功能,会生成一个默认的 tsconfig.json 文件。 bash tsc --init Created a new tsconfig.json with: TS target: es2016 module: commonjs strict: true esModuleInterop: true skipLibCheck: true forceConsistentCasingInFileNames: true You can learn...
npm install --save-dev typescript npx tsc --init 这将创建一个tsconfig.json文件,你可以根据需要调整配置。 2. 安装Vue 3的TypeScript支持 安装Vue 3的TypeScript支持库: 代码语言:txt 复制 npm install --save-dev @vue/compiler-sfc 3. 修改Vite配置 在vite.config.js或vite.config.ts文件中,你...